1. Are HexArmor anti-fog safety glasses actually worth the extra cost?

Short answer: yes, if your team works in humid or temperature-changing environments. I learned this the hard way. A few years ago, I bought cheap anti-fog glasses from a generic supplier—saved about $3 per pair upfront. Within two months, the coating wore off, fogging returned, and workers tossed them for disposable ones. The real cost? $8 per pair every 6 weeks vs. HexArmor's anti-fog glasses (which last 6–9 months with proper care). In my spreadsheet, that's a 65% lower total cost per year.

(HexArmor's anti-fog uses a permanent hydrophilic coating, not a spray-on layer. That's the difference—it won't wash off after 10 cleanings.)

2. What makes the Lift hard hat different from standard hard hats?

The Lift hard hat is HexArmor's lightweight design (about 350g vs. typical 400–450g). For a worker wearing it 8 hours, that's less neck strain and—more importantly—higher compliance. I've seen crews take off heavy helmets just "for a minute" and forget to put them back. That minute is the risk. The Lift also has a 6-point suspension system, which spreads impact better. But here's the catch: it costs about 25% more than a basic hard hat. From a cost perspective, the ROI comes from reduced injury claims and audit fines. One serious head injury claim can wipe out 10 years of savings from cheaper helmets. (Thankfully, we've never had one—but I've seen it happen at a peer company.)

4. Which PPE combination protects you best from liquid chemicals?

If you're dealing with liquid chemicals (acids, solvents, etc.), the hierarchy goes: chemical-resistant gloves → face shield → apron → boots. For gloves, HexArmor's DTM (Dry Tactical Machine) series has a cut level A9 and a coated palm that resists many chemicals—but always check the chemical compatibility chart. Safety glasses alone won't stop a splash; you need a face shield over them. And here's where I made a mistake: I once assumed "chemical-resistant" meant "all chemicals." It doesn't. In 2022, one of our techs got a mild skin irritation from a solvent that penetrated his nitrile glove. Turns out the solvent was a known permeation hazard for that glove material. We switched to HexArmor's PVC-coated style for that specific job. Moral: always match the glove to the chemical, not the brand.

5. How does HexArmor's total cost compare to cheaper alternatives?

I built a TCO model for our top 5 glove brands last year. HexArmor's cut-resistant gloves (A5 level) cost about $12–18 per pair vs. $8–10 for generics. Looking at just price per pair, you'd think generics win. But when I tracked usage:

  • Generic gloves lasted 2–3 shifts before tearing or losing grip
  • HexArmor gloves lasted 8–12 shifts
  • Plus, fewer injuries = less downtime and paperwork

Net result: HexArmor cost $0.12 per shift vs. generics at $0.18 per shift. Not a huge difference, but over 200 workers that's about $2,000 saved annually. And that's not counting the headache of frequent reordering. (From my perspective, the real win is having a reliable vendor that doesn't suddenly run out of stock.)

7. What's one thing I should have done differently?

Looking back, I should have tested gear before committing to a large order. We once bought 500 pairs of a new safety glasses model (not HexArmor) based on a trade show demo. Turned out the anti-fog coating was only good for 5 washes—after that, fog city. (Ugh, I really should have asked for 30-day field test samples.) Since then, I always ask vendors for a small trial batch. HexArmor offers sample programs—use them. It'll save you thousands in wrong purchases.
